1: Sculptural Wall Art – More Than Meets the Eye
Sculptural wall art is not just about visual appeal, but it engages multiple senses, adding depth and character to your living space. Unlike traditional flat art, sculptural pieces create shadows, movement, and a tangible presence in your room. They invite touch and interaction, making them a multi-dimensional experience.
These pieces aren’t just for the walls; they’re an integral part of your room’s architecture. You can choose from an array of materials such as metal, wood, ceramics, or glass, each offering unique textures and a distinct visual language. Whether you prefer modern, abstract, or traditional styles, there’s a sculptural wall art piece for every taste.
2: Playing with Light and Shadow
One of the remarkable aspects of sculptural wall art is its ability to play with light and shadow. As the sunlight or artificial lighting changes throughout the day, these pieces cast captivating shadows that dance across your walls, giving your room an ever-evolving ambiance. The interplay of light and shadow adds an element of surprise, making your space feel dynamic and engaging.
Consider a metal sculpture that reflects light in a stunning way or a wooden piece with intricate cutouts that create enchanting patterns on your walls. These dynamic effects can’t be achieved with traditional flat art, making sculptural wall art painting a must-have for those who want to infuse their space with a touch of magic.

5: Versatile Placement and Arrangement
Sculptural wall art is incredibly versatile in terms of placement and arrangement. While paintings often require dedicated wall space, sculptural pieces can be incorporated into various areas of your home. You can position them above a fireplace, behind your dining table, in a hallway, or even on the exterior of your house, creating a cohesive and striking look for your entire property.
The arrangement of sculptural wall art is also a creative endeavor. You can mix and match different pieces to tell a unique visual story. Consider arranging smaller sculptures in a cluster or creating a gallery wall with a variety of materials and styles. The possibilities are endless, allowing you to tailor your decor to your personal taste and the layout of your space.
